所以我做了大量的阅读和搜索,但似乎无法弄清楚这一点。我有一个typescript类,如下所示 import * as Shopify from 'shopify-api-node'; }
} 这个类只由多个函数组成,这些函数进行graphQL调用(this.shopify.graphql)并返回结果。我想模拟shop
好的,我的代码中的控制器连接到外部api解析并以JSON的形式返回。我正在尝试运行一个测试,以便它返回我的应用程序逻辑的结果。不幸的是,在测试期间,我无法与api github连接。details = new RepositoryDetailsResponse();
details.setDescription("Ruby toolkit for the GitHub API</em
我正在写一个typeScript程序,它命中一个外部应用程序接口。在为这个程序编写测试的过程中,我无法正确地模拟出对外部API的依赖,这种方式允许我检查传递给API本身的值。我的代码访问API的简化版本如下所示: const api = require("api-name")();
export class DataMana